On August 20, the People's Committee of Vung Tau City ( Ba Ria - Vung Tau province) organized the announcement of the project to adjust the 1/500 planning of Mui Nghinh Phong area, Ward 2, Vung Tau City.
Nghinh Phong Cape is located at the foot of the hill and is the starting point of Thuy Van Park with a beautiful location. In front is the sea, behind is the mountain, surrounded by famous spots such as "Heaven's Gate", "Con Heo Hill" and is a place where you can watch both sunset and sunrise in Vung Tau.
Mui Nghinh Phong area is planned to be a high-class tourist service area.
Nghinh Phong Cape is considered as "golden land" in Vung Tau City, with 13.8 hectares planned as a high-quality tourism, entertainment and resort service area, ensuring harmonious development with the surrounding landscape and environment.
Specifically, the land will be planned as a high-rise entertainment and tourism service area with a maximum height of 10 floors, a combined construction density of 45%, a height sufficient to become a highlight but not obstructing the view of locations in the area. In which, floors 1-3 are used for commercial-service purposes; floors 4-10 are for high-end resorts.

For low-rise tourism service projects, there will be a cluster of projects with hotel characteristics, modern lines, and a construction density of 35%.
In addition, there will be a central service complex, a central open space connecting Ha Long Road to the beach and Hon Ba Island. This traffic route will serve the public for residents and tourists. Hon Ba will also be kept in its original state and the stone road leading to the island.
Vung Tau City People's Committee said the goal of the planning is to maximize the natural landscape towards the sea, preserve natural sand beaches, plan large open spaces on the main axis, and continuous walking paths to connect the entire area, serving the maximum demand for high-quality resorts for tourists.

The architectural plan of the project needs to ensure continuous spatial connection, without obstructing the view of the Back Beach area, Con Heo hill location, Nho mountain area, and Christ statue on the basis of taking advantage of traffic, landscape and land use conditions.
